The Insulative Core: Material and Performance


The visible tubing in the kit consists of polyolefin, a common thermoplastic polymer known for its excellent insulation properties. This material provides a durable, flexible, and chemically resistant barrier once shrunk. Polyolefin is a reliable choice for electrical isolation.

This material choice implies a high degree of protection for conductors, preventing short circuits and environmental damage. The tubing forms a tight seal around connections, which is critical for long-term reliability in harsh conditions. It resists common solvents and oils.

Unlike standard PVC insulation, polyolefin heat shrink offers enhanced mechanical strength and a higher operating temperature range. This makes it suitable for demanding applications where simple tape might degrade or unravel. It's a significant upgrade.

Wire Repair and Reinforcement


One of the most common applications for this kit is the repair of damaged wire insulation. Instead of replacing an entire cable, a section of heat shrink tubing can effectively restore the protective layer. This extends the life of existing equipment.

For instance, if a power cord's outer jacket is frayed near the plug, a piece of appropriately sized heat shrink can be slid over the damaged area and shrunk into place. This prevents further damage and potential electrical hazards. It's a quick fix.

This method offers a more permanent and aesthetically pleasing repair than wrapping with tape, which can unravel or become sticky over time. The heat shrink molds to the wire, providing continuous, seamless protection. It looks professional.

Electrical Connection Sealing


When joining two wires, especially in environments exposed to moisture or abrasion, heat shrink tubing provides an essential protective seal. It encapsulates the splice, preventing corrosion and mechanical stress.

Consider automotive wiring, where connections are constantly exposed to vibrations, temperature fluctuations, and road salt. A properly sealed heat shrink connection maintains signal integrity and prevents premature failure. Reliability is paramount.

This level of sealing surpasses what can be achieved with friction tape or even self-amalgamating tape for individual connections, offering a more robust and long-lasting barrier. It's a superior barrier.

Installation Protocol: Achieving a Perfect Seal


The application process for heat shrink tubing is straightforward but requires a controlled heat source. The images demonstrate a four-step process: position, cover, heat, and secure. Proper technique ensures optimal results.

First, the correct size of tubing is selected and slid over one end of the wire or connection. The connection is then made, typically by soldering or crimping. The tubing is then positioned centrally over the joint.

Finally, heat is applied evenly to the tubing using a heat gun or a controlled flame (like a lighter, with caution). The material shrinks to approximately half its original diameter, forming a tight, protective sleeve. Even heat is crucial.

This process creates a durable, form-fitting seal that is resistant to environmental factors. The shrinking action expels air, creating a compact and secure covering. It's a permanent bond.

Material Science and Durability: A Closer Look


The 2:1 shrink ratio indicated on the packaging is standard for general-purpose heat shrink tubing. This means a tube will shrink to half its original diameter when heated. This ratio is versatile.

This shrink ratio ensures that the tubing can accommodate a range of wire sizes within its specified diameter, providing a snug fit even if the initial wire diameter is slightly smaller than the tube's un-shrunk size. It offers flexibility.

Many specialized heat shrink tubes offer higher shrink ratios (e.g., 3:1 or 4:1) for irregular shapes or larger diameter differences. However, for general electrical work, a 2:1 ratio is perfectly adequate and cost-effective. It covers most needs.

The flame retardant property, often associated with polyolefin heat shrink, is a critical safety feature. In the event of an electrical fault or external heat source, the tubing resists ignition and self-extinguishes. This minimizes fire risk.

This characteristic is particularly important in automotive or industrial applications where electrical fires can have severe consequences. It adds a layer of safety that standard non-flame retardant materials lack. Safety is paramount.

While not explicitly stated for this specific product, most quality polyolefin heat shrink tubing offers excellent dielectric strength, meaning it can withstand high electrical voltages without breaking down. This is fundamental for insulation. It prevents arcing.
